A delicious iftar under QR50 in Qatar? Yes my foodie friends it can be done. Like many who have contacted me, I’ve been surprised at the general prices for iftar this Ramadan. This is a combination of sticker shock from the two year COVID-19 hiatus and a general indication of the rising prices globally. Knowing so many people are seeking value for money, I thought a look at what iftars can be bought for QR50 was worth exploring. This is Qatar’s year and all signs point to the 2022 FIFA World Cup. And, it’s fair to say that the food and beverage scene is matching that energy. Believe it or not there are more than 3000 restaurants, cafes and eateries in Qatar and that number is growing every day.
